On Thu, Mar 11, 2010 at 2:13 PM, Robert Haas <robertmhaas@gmail.com> wrote: > On Mon, Mar 8, 2010 at 5:19 AM, Savita <savita.halli@gmail.com> wrote: > > > > The following bug has been logged online: > > > > Bug reference: 5365 > > Logged by: Savita > > Email address: savita.halli@gmail.com > > PostgreSQL version: 8.3.5 > > Operating system: SunOS 5.10 Generic_139555-08 sun4u sparc > > SUNW,Sun-Fire-V440 > > Description: pg_ctl start gives error > > Details: > > > > Hi > > > > I have installed postgres in Solaris machine and trying to start the > service > > and it fails with follwoing error > > > > FATAL: syntax error in file "../../pgsql/data/postgresql.conf" line 107, > > near token "MB" > > > > By seeing the error I thought the problem could be with postgresql.conf > > file. But I copied this file from other machine(SunOS 5.10 > Generic_118833-33 > > sun4v sparc sun4v) where postgres start/stop works fine still gives the > same > > error in this box. > > > > Is it something to do with version of SunOS? > > I doubt it. postgresql.conf should be parsed identically on any > platform, I would think. > I've seen this when I accidentally use the wrong pg_ctl on a data directory (i.e. my 8.1 pg_ctl is in the PATH and I use it to try and start an 8.3 cluster). --Scott M
